Abstract
We use the method of QCD sum rules in the presence of an external pion field to investigate isospin symmetry breakings in pion-nucleon couplings. Possible manifestations of such isospin symmetry breaking are examined in the context of low-energy nucleon-nucleon () scattering. We discuss numerical results in relation to both the existing data and other theoretical predictions.
